What is Medical Nutrition Therapy?
Medical Nutrition Therapy (MNT) is individualized dietary instruction that incorporates diet therapy counseling for a nutrition related problem. This level of specialized instruction is above basic nutrition counseling and includes an individualized dietary assessment. A Registered Dietitian Nutritionist licensed in the state of Illinois can provide these services, which may include an initial nutrition and lifestyle assessment, one on one nutritional counseling, and followup visits to check on your progress in managing your diet. The RDN often acts as part of a medical team, in various practice settings, such as hospitals, physician offices, private practices and other health care facilities. Medical nutrition therapy is covered by a variety of insurance plans, such as Medicare and private insurances. Medicare Part B covers medical nutrition therapy for diabetes and kidney disease. If you have private insurance, check with your insurance plan for specific medical nutrition therapy coverage details or dietitian services. Your plan may cover nutrition counseling for a wide variety of chronic conditions and health concerns, such as heart disease, diabetes and obesity. Medical nutrition therapy provided by an RDN includes:
- Review of what you eat and your eating habits
- Thorough review of your nutritional health
- Personalized nutrition treatment plan
